Khurmabad Population - Barwani, Madhya Pradesh
Khurmabad is a large village located in Sendhwa Tehsil of Barwani district, Madhya Pradesh with total 797 families residing. The Khurmabad village has population of 5466 of which 2695 are males while 2771 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Khurmabad village population of children with age 0-6 is 1350 which makes up 24.70 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Khurmabad village is 1028 which is higher than Madhya Pradesh state average of 931. Child Sex Ratio for the Khurmabad as per census is 1143, higher than Madhya Pradesh average of 918.
Khurmabad village has lower literacy rate compared to Madhya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Khurmabad village was 30.52 % compared to 69.32 % of Madhya Pradesh. In Khurmabad Male literacy stands at 34.72 % while female literacy rate was 26.28 %.

Khurmabad Data
|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total No. of Houses | 797 | - | - |
| Population | 5,466 | 2,695 | 2,771 |
| Child (0-6) | 1,350 | 630 | 720 |
| Schedule Caste | 454 | 227 | 227 |
| Schedule Tribe | 4,934 | 2,428 | 2,506 |
| Literacy | 30.52 % | 34.72 % | 26.28 % |
| Total Workers | 2,964 | 1,508 | 1,456 |
| Main Worker | 1,749 | - | - |
| Marginal Worker | 1,215 | 223 | 992 |
